2. Emerging Solar Panel Technologies
The efficiency of solar panels has come a long way over the last few years, yet there are still plenty of possibilities for enhancement. Emerging solar panel modern technologies have the potential to reinvent the sector and make solar energy even more obtainable for individuals worldwide. Take Aiko Power's cutting-edge new bifacial photovoltaic panel, for instance. This item uses two panels as opposed to one, enabling it to soak up light from both sides and produce as much as 30% even more energy than traditional single-panel systems.
Various other emerging modern technologies consist of clear solar batteries that can be related to home windows and developing exteriors, as well as paintable solar batteries that can be used to transform any surface into an energy-generating property. These materials offer amazing opportunities for making existing buildings more power efficient without requiring added area or building work. Additionally, they could be used in position like deserts and other remote areas that do not have access to typical grid infrastructure.

Nevertheless, photovoltaic panels still have environmental impacts. They need materials to make, which can include mining and chemical make use of that can be damaging to the setting. They additionally use up a lot of room, so they may create environment loss or damage when set up in areas with delicate ecological communities. Furthermore, they need maintenance to keep them working appropriately, which can result in lose generation or water contamination if done improperly. In general, solar panels are an environmentally friendly choice when used sensibly and carefully handled.
